2012-04-13 13:00:00 (link to chat)Can the Brewers approach last year's 96 wins with three upgrades defensively on the infield and a stable bullpen? Health of the starting rotation has to be the biggest factor, doesn't it? They were incredibly healthy last season.
(Matt from Eau Claire, WI)
Absolutely. They were middle of the pack defensively last year, though much improved over the year before - Ron Roenicke's willingness to shift (the Brewers did so more often than any other team) appears to have been a factor, and losing Yuniesky Betancourt shouldn't hurt.

The Brewers have one of the league's strongest rotations 1-5, but they don't have much organizational depth beyond that, so yes, it's important they stay healthy. If they do, I suspect they can contend again in the NL Central. (Jay Jaffe)
2011-05-12 13:00:00 (link to chat)Break down Ron Roenicke as a manager for me. Strengths, weaknesses. Do you still like him?
(The Common Man from Getting Closer)
The Brewers have been playing way too poorly recently to give him a fair shake. He has issues with the lineup (in batting order and defensive position). For some reason, he's in love with Mark Kotsay, even going to so far as to start him in CF yesterday over Brandon Boggs. A lot of Brewers fans hate Roenicke's tendency to go for extra bases, but I'm not jumping on that yet. Doing the Tracker, I've gotten used to subconsciously timing players as they move around the field... if done right, extra bases are definitely there for the taking. Players need to be wiser about it, though.

He hasn't gotten off to a great start yet, that's for sure. (Larry Granillo)
